I’ve never been to Clearwater Beach, but I have to say this hotel was super convenient and incredibly valuable for the price. To start, yes, the parking is $29, a day but you get the service of a 24/7 valet. Also, if the price truly bothers you, you can get creative with paying for street parking or looking for cheaper lots. Check-in was great. I got in a little late and there were no issues with getting me into the room I booked. The Rooftop Bar is beyond gorgeous. You’ll feel relaxed just sitting up there and having a drink with family, friends or colleagues. The cocktails are a little pricey (avg $15). But the draft beers are regularly priced. However the rooftop is open from 4p-11p on weekdays and 4p-Midnight on weekends. My only recommendation would be extending the hours. The pool area is also incredibly spacious. The pool itself is pretty long for a non-resort hotel pool. Also, it’s under an awning that provides some reprieve from the sun. The pool area also had an outdoor ping pong table and connect 4 which I found to be a cute attention to detail. The gym is also A++++ with top of the line treadmills, functional trainers, medicine balls, dumbbells and more. Plus the treadmills are facing the marina. The view as your on the treadmill is just splendid!! Although the elevator was down, it was NOT a big deal AT ALL. The hotel was up front that housekeeping is every other day. However, we asked for towels and they were there within 5 minutes. Lastly, literally everything is within walking distance. From cvs, Walgreens, the beach, pizza spots, breakfast, ice cream, fine dining, beach bars, beach eateries, pier 60, and all the popular spots. This place is in the center of it all. Unless you’re specifically seeking out a resort style with private beach and chairs, this is your place. However, the area of public beach by the hotel is not overpopulated at all. Bring your own chair and umbrella and you are in business. Highly, highly recommend!

Bread new hotels (2021) are almost always a delight, and the Courtyard here has several things going for it on top. Super clean, new smell, and modern styling. And absolutely everyone we interacted with on the staff, from valet to desk to housekeeping, we're great hires. That said, there are some peculiarities in the design and amenities that faced cost reduction instead of improving guest experience. That said, you're either picking this hotel because your first choices are sold out, or, you're just supremely loyal to the Courtyard, business traveler-focused brand. I can imagine the build quality of this hotel will wear in a couple years (particularly in a beach area), so enjoy it while you can. Already saw some wear on the bathroom sink and the windows. We ended up in the last available room last weekend, a 2 Queen Suite. I'd design the room layout to be more functional, but spacious is definitely an accurate descriptor. No true ocean views here, but you can see it around the condos on the beach with enough satisfaction. If I'm being overly particular about a Courtyard, it's because average costs for this one is in the $300-600s per night. If a hotel charges 4-star hotel prices, I'd like to see 4-star amenities to go along. Otherwise, you might as well pay the same amount for a true 4-star on the ⛱️. Overall impressions were met, and I'd not hesitate stay here again if the main resorts on the beach were sold out again.
